Foley's Bar is a great place to simply enjoy a beer in peace. It's a quaint pub with an adjoining dining room. This is where the locals meet, so it's not a tourist trap. There was live music on Wednesday. The food was excellent. The spring rolls were fresh and homemade. The cake for dessert was top-notch. The bar has retained the charm of decades past.

Hands down this was the stand out evening of a lengthy run down Ireland’s wild Atlantic coast. After a hard day’s sunbathing on Inch beach, I rang and was recommended to come earlier rather than later as they had live music. After a quick scrub at the campsite, I walked up to the pub, ordered a pint and went to listen to a fabulous group of friends singing to what seemed like more friends. Couldn’t decide between ordering mussels or the local Annascaul black pudding. Obviously I chose both. With pint of the black stuff. After disposing of that I rejoined the singing and dancing. Huge thanks to the bar and restaurant staff and of course, to the group that charmed and entertained us all.
